Forward mix is going to be so interesting this year:
who takes s garys spot?

presumebly as of right now best 6 stucture could be:
ff:ladhams dixon gray
hf:rozee marshall butters

Does ken do what ken does best and only play one of ladhams and marshall?
Rozee could possibly be moved out to play more mid. As does r gray

You dont recruit three forwards with high picks just for them to sit in the twos especially some with ready made bodies and kens likeliness to play 1rounders straight away. Theyre all different types of forwards: williams is a monfties/wingard lead up forward pocket. Georgiades is more of a lynch up the ground chain player and Bergman is more of a flanker high hurt factor low possesion player as of right now.

In saying that where do our young untried forwards fit in? Tobin cox will debut at somepoint. Woodcock relegated to rookie list but can play. farrell is a proven finisher and has kicked bags at afl level just needs to up his possesion count. Then you have old mate motlop. A returning and reinvented marking forward in Ebert. And ready made buzza and hayes

Thats about 8-10 players vying for similar spots. Given Rozee and Gray could very well play more mid. Ladhams and Marshall could be head to head for the same spot. The only real lock is dixon but there could be more to open up.

Haha. The endless debate. Is Gunston a KPF? To my mind he is, but I understand why some question that. He is not the prototypical Lockett, Ablett or Carey. He is more of an O'Loughlin type.

There are 'nice' KPF's who are successful. They need to have the confidence and competitive spirit to get the most out of themselves though. I would point to O'Loughlin, Dunstall, Hawkins and Schultz as examples. Gunston too. Marshall certainly needs to at least develop a body which enables him to be more of a contested threat as well, especially for our purposes.
